Miracle On 34th Street

Royal and Derngate Theatre 19-21 Guildhall Road, Northampton, Northamptonshire, NN1 1DP

A true Christmas classic comes alive this holiday season with White Cobra‘s staged radio performance of Miracle On 34th Street.  The story is based on the famous 1947 film, which was first presented as a radio play at the Lux Radio Theatre. A formidable Macy’s store executive, Doris Walker is desperately searching for a new store Santa Claus.  She hires ‘Kris Kringle’ who insists that he is the real Santa Claus and proves immensely popular.  However, when a conflict with the store’s incompetent psychologist erupts, Kris finds himself at Bellevue where, in despair, he deliberately fails a psychological test.  All seems lost until Doris’ friend, Fred Gailey, reassures Kris of his worth and agrees to represent him in the fight to secure his release.  Fred arranges a hearing in which he argues that Kris is sane because he is in fact the real Santa Claus! The White Cobra cast bring alive a lively crew of characters, with radio jingles and sound effects that will delight audiences, young and old.

Mog’s Christmas

Royal and Derngate Theatre 19-21 Guildhall Road, Northampton, Northamptonshire, NN1 1DP

It's Christmas time, and the Thomas family are looking back on the past year and all the adventures they've shared with their cat, Mog from catching a burglar in the spring to a dramatic summer chase at the V.E.T. Now as they prepare for the festive season, Mog is baffled by strange noises, peculiar smells, and what's this? A tree moving indoors! Amidst the festive chaos, will Mog ever come inside for Christmas? Join Mog and the Thomas family for a heartwarming Christmas adventure filled with surprises, snowy mischief, and the true meaning of family. The Wardrobe Ensemble (whose The Stage Award-winning Education, Education, Education transferred from Royal & Derngate to the West End) adapt Judith Kerr's beloved and iconic stories for the stage in a lively and enchanting production directed by Helena Middleton (Pippi Longstocking), with songs, live music, and a menagerie of creatures little and large. These timeless tales of family, friendship, and festive fun are brought to life to allow a new generation of children to fall in love with Mog.
